Resumen:
Chitosan is a plysaccharide derived from the deacetylation of chitin (the second most abudant polymer after cellulose). Chitosan is soluble in acid medium and insoluble in basic medium and can be easily handled, formatted and chemically modified to be used in variety of applications in food, pharmaceutical and material fields. Here we report the production of highly porous chitosan mini-spheres and membranes, and their chemical modification to perform low-cost protein purification processes.
